Rozwiązania
Edytor grafiki wektorowej Inkscape
Edytor grafiki
wektorowej Inkscape
Paweł Aupkowski
Spośród wielu dostępnych w Linuksie edytorów grafi ki wektorowej (takich jak Xfi g, Xara X, Sodipodi
czy Krita) na szczególną uwagę zasługuje Inkscape. Projekt ten będący forkiem projektu Sodipodi
wyróżnia się przejrzystym interfejsem oraz dużymi możliwościami importu i eksportu grafi k. Autorzy
Inkscape'a porównują program do Corela i Illustratora. Podstawowym formatem plików Inkscape jest
standard Scalable Vector Graphics (SVG) stworzony przez W3C.
nstalacja programu nie powinna być kłopotliwa, się paleta kolorów oraz informacje o wybranym kolorze i
ponieważ znajduje się on w repozytoriach popu- rodzaju wypełnienia i konturów obiektów rysunkowych.
larnych dystrybucji Linuksa oraz w portach sys- Domyślnie rozmiar nowego dokumentu to A4 piono-
Itemów z rodziny BSD. Aby zainstalować Inksca- wo. Aby zmienić ustawienia strony wybieramy Plik >
pe w Ubuntu wystarczy wpisać w konsoli sudo apt-get Ustawienia dokumentu. Możemy również skorzystać z
install inkscape lub wybrać pakiet Inkscape w gra- jednego z predefiniowanych rozmiarów, które znajdzie-
ficznym menedżerze pakietów (np. Synapticu). W tym my w menu Plik > Nowy (m. in. standardowe wymiary
artykule opisuję Inkscape w wersji 0.45. pulpitów, ikon itp).
Obsługa programu jest bardzo intuicyjna i szybko
można osiągnąć ciekawe efekty. Inkcape sprawdza się Tworzenie obiektów rysunkowych
zarówno jako typowy program do tworzenia grafiki arty- Tworzenie obiektów rysunkowych przebiega standardo-
stycznej, jak i grafiki na potrzeby WWW (banerów, na- wo. Wybieramy odpowiednie narzędzie z bocznego pa-
główków stron a nawet całych layoutów) czy też różne- ska narzędziowego (kwadrat, okrąg lub wielokąt) i trzy-
go rodzaju wykresów i ilustracji. Inkscape pozwala rów- mając lewy klawisz myszy przeciągamy po obszarze ry-
nież na importowanie i edycję grafiki rastrowej. sunku do uzyskania pożądanych rozmiarów.
Menu programu jest standardowe i przypomina nie- Przy rysowaniu prostokąta/kwadratu, po utworze-
co układ stosowany w programie O.O. Draw lub Xara X. niu obiektu, możemy dowolnie zaokrąglić jego rogi. Wy-
Na górze okna mamy główne menu programu i dwa pa- starczy wybrać podświetlony punkt na konturze i przecią-
ski narzędziowe, zawierające informacje o edytowanych gnąć myszką w dół. Wszystkie rogi obiektu zostaną za-
obiektach oraz podstawowe opcje ustawień i konfiguracji. okrąglone.
Boczny pasek zawiera narzędzia tworzenia rozmaitych Podobnej manipulacji możemy poddać koło/elipsę. Tym
obiektów rysunkowych. Na dole okna programu znajduje razem manipulowanie podświetlonym punktem na kon-
32 czerwiec 2008
linux@software.com.pl
Rozwiązania
Edytor grafiki wektorowej Inkscape
turze obiektu pozwala na wycinanie fragmen- sne, korzystając z narzędzia rysunku od- żemy zmienić krój, rozmiar, efekty czcion-
tów koła. Przy rysowaniu wielokątów (ikona ręcznego lub krzywych Beziera. Aby dodać ki, wyrównanie tekstu oraz jego układ po-
w kształcie gwiazdy w bocznym pasku narzę- tekst do dokumentu wybieramy ikonę z lite- ziomo lub pionowo). Wstawionym tekstem
dziowym) ilość krawędzi obiektu wybieramy, rą A z bocznego paska narzędziowego. Na- możemy również manipulować po wybra-
po utworzeniu obiektu, z górnego paska narzę- stępnie tworzymy ramkę tekstową w miej- niu ikony T z górnego paska narzędziowego
dziowego. scu, gdzie chcemy wstawić tekst. Parametry (lub [Shift]+[Ctrl]+[T]). Otworzy się wtedy
Oczywiście zamiast korzystać z goto- tekstu możemy zmienić od razu, korzystając okno dialogowe, gdzie w pierwszej zakład-
wych kształtów możemy narysować wła- z górnego paska narzędziowego (gdzie mo- ce znajdziemy wspomniane już opcje doty-
czące tekstu oraz podgląd zmian, zaś w dru-
giej zakładce możemy wpisywać i modyfi-
kować treść. Po zakończonej edycji tekstu
litery zamieniane są na krzywe, dzięki cze-
mu całość traktowana jest jako obiekt ry-
sunkowy.
Modyfikacja obiektów
Utworzone obiekty możemy dowolnie mo-
dyfikować. Zaznaczenie obiektu pojedyn-
czym kliknięciem pozwala na modyfiko-
wanie jego wielkości i położenia (wokół
obiektu pojawią się strzałki). Przy zmianie
rozmiaru obiektu warto zwrócić uwagę na
ikonę kłódki znajdującej się pomiędzy wy-
miarem poziomym i pionowym w górnym
pasku narzędziowym. Przy wciśniętej iko-
nie zmiany rozmiaru będą proporcjonal-
ne. Kolejne kliknięcie umożliwia obracanie
obiektu (strzałki zmienią wygląd). W jego
Rysunek 1. Inkscape. Interfejs programu jest przejrzysty i intuicyjny (przypomina nieco O.O. Draw i Xarę X).
centrum pojawi się krzyżyk, który oznacza
Wszystkie narzędzia rysunkowe znajdziemy w lewym pasku.
punkt odniesienia przy obracaniu. Możemy
go dowolnie ustawiać na obszarze edytowa-
nego obiektu w zależności od potrzeb.
W górnym pasku narzędziowym (lewa
krawędz) znajdują się narzędzia pozwalają-
ce na obracanie obiektu o 90 stopni w lewo
lub w prawo oraz odbijanie obiektu pionowo
lub poziomo.
Obiekty możemy dowolnie grupować i roz-
grupowywać. Aby z kilku elementów utwo-
rzyć jeden obiekt zaznaczamy je i wybiera-
my ikonę grupowania obiektów z górnego pa-
ska narzędziowego (lub klawisze [Ctrl]+[G]).
Rysunek 2. Okno dialogowe ustawień obiektów rysunkowych daje dostęp do manipulacji wypełnieniem, kon-
Rozgrupowanie obiektów uzyskujemy wybie-
turem, poziomem ich rozmycia i przezroczystości.
rając ikonę rozgrupowania z paska narzędzio-
wego lub kombinację klawiszy [Ctrl]+[Shi-
ft]+[G].
Ustawienia dotyczące wypełnienia i obra-
Przydatne skróty klawiaturowe
mowania obiektów znajdziemy w oknie dia-
logowym uruchamianym po wybraniu ikony
" Ustawienia dokumentu [Ctrl]+[Shift]+[D]
pędzla z górnego paska narzędziowego lub
" Import bitmapy [Ctrl]+[I]
skrótu klawiszowego [Ctrl] + [Shift] + [F]. W
" Eksport bitmapy [Ctrl]+[Shift]+[E]
pierwszej zakładce okna właściwości może-
" Wektoryzuj bitmapę [Shift]+[Alt]+[B]
my ustawić rodzaj i kolor wypełnienia. Usta-
" Okno dialogowe właściwości obiektu [Ctrl]+[Shift]+[F]
wiamy tu również poziom nieprzepuszczalno-
" Okno dialogowe właściwości tekstu [Ctrl]+[Shift]+[T]
ści koloru obiektu oraz poziom jego rozmycia
" Okno dialogowe warstw [Ctrl]+[Shift]+[L]
(te parametry pozwalają na osiągnięcie cieka-
" Wyrównanie i rozłożenie obiektów [Ctrl]+[Shift]+[A]
wych efektów rysunkowych). Druga i trzecia
" Grupuj obiekty [Ctrl]+[G]
zakładka pozwala na ustawienia koloru, gru-
" Rozgrupuj obiekty [Ctrl]+[Shift]+[G]
bości i wykończenia konturu obiektu.
www.lpmagazine.org 33
Rozwiązania
Edytor grafiki wektorowej Inkscape
Jeśli jako rodzaj wypełnienia obiektu ny ze strzałką w prawym dolnym rogu okna obiekt do naszego dokumentu. Możemy
lub konturu wybraliśmy gradient, możemy programu. również zaimportować grafikę przy pomo-
go dowolnie modyfikować. Wystarczy wy- cy metody przeciągnij i upuść. Eksport gra-
brać ikonę edycji gradientu z paska narzę- Import/eksport grafiki fiki odbywa się w analogiczny sposób. Mo-
dziowego z boku okna programu (lub kom- Domyślnie Inkscape zapisuje wszystkie żemy wyeksportować cały obrazek, lub tyl-
binację klawiszy [Ctrl]+[F1]). pliki jako SVG (czyli w formacie wekto- ko wskazany zaznaczeniem fragment. Eks-
Ciekawą funkcjonalnością Inkscape'a jest rowym przygotowanym przez W3C). Ta- portowana grafika zapisywana jest w for-
możliwość wyboru stosowanej palety kolo- kie pliki możemy pózniej wykorzysty- macie .png.
rów w zależności od rodzaju realizowanego wać i edytować m. in. w Sodipodi, Xarze
projektu graficznego. X, Scribusie, GIMPie (po dodaniu wtycz- Wektoryzacja bitmap
Możemy np. ograniczyć paletę kolo- ki gimp-svg) lub Synfigu. Inkscape umoż- Zaimportowane pliki, które nie są w for-
rów do tzw. bezpiecznych kolorów WWW, liwia też import i eksport grafiki rastrowej macie wektorowym możemy na taki prze-
jeśli przygotowujemy grafikę na potrzeby (np. jpg, gif, png). kształcić. Dzięki temu możemy je edytować
strony internetowej lub wybrać paletę ko- Import obrazu jest bardzo prosty wy- tak, jak inne obiekty rysunkowe stworzone
lorów zmodyfikowaną na potrzeby tworze- starczy wybrać ikonę importu z górnego w Inkscape. Aby to zrobić zaznaczamy za-
nia ikon określonego rodzaju. Opcje pale- paska narzędziowego i wskazać plik do importowaną grafikę i wybieramy z menu
ty kolorów dostępne są po kliknięciu iko- importu. Obraz zostanie wstawiony jako Ścieżka > Wektoryzuj bitmapę.
W oknie dialogowym wybieramy od-
powiadający nam rodzaj wektoryzacji. Za-
nim zatwierdzimy wybór możemy obej-
W Sieci
rzeć efekty na podglądzie po prawej stro-
nie okna dialogowego (kolejne zmiany wy-
" Strona domowa Inkscape: http://www.inkscape.org/
magają uaktualnienia podglądu przyci-
" Bogaty zestaw tutoriali Inkscape: http://inkscapetutorials.wordpress.com/
skiem [Update]). Po uzyskaniu odpowied-
" Tutoriale w postaci prezentacji wideo: http://screencasters.heathenx.org/
niego efektu zatwierdzamy zmiany przyci-
" O formacie SVG: http://www.w3.org/Graphics/SVG/
skiem [OK].
" Grafika wektorowa (Wikipedia): http://pl.wikipedia.org/wiki/Grafika_wektorowa
Ten krótki tekst przedstawia jedynie po-
bieżny (i subiektywny) przegląd możliwo-
ści programu Inkscape.
Zainteresowanym czytelnikom polecam
O autorze
odwiedziny stron internetowych wymienio-
nych w ramce W Sieci (szczególnie http://
Autor jest doktorantem w Instytucie Psychologii UAM (Zakład Logiki i Kognitywistyki).
screencasters.heathenx.org/). Tych bardziej
Pracuje na GNU/Linuksie od początku swojej przygody z komputerami (aktualnie jest to
dociekliwych zachęcam również do ekspe-
Ubuntu 7.04). Interesuje się szczególnie edytorami tekstu oraz programami grafi cznymi
rymentowania z samym programem.
z rodziny open source.
Kontakt z autorem: p_lupkowski@o2.pl
Rysunek 3. Manipulacja poziomem rozmycia i przezroczystości pozwala na osiągnięcie bardzo ciekawych
Rysunek 4. Inkscape umożliwia wybór palety, na któ-
efektów.
rej będziemy pracowali.
34 czerwiec 2008
Wyszukiwarka
Podobne podstrony:
Grafika wektorwa cw 2Grafika wektorowaTechniki multimedialne Grafika wektorowa2008 06 Tworzenie i edycja grafiki online [Grafika]2008 06 Programowanie grafiki [Programowanie]Grafika wektorwa cw 1Grafika wektorowa rastrowaw6 grafika wektorowaKonkrety grafiki wektorowej3 Grafika wektorowa i bitmapowa2008 09 Trzy wymiary Blendera [Grafika]Arch grafika osnovi kompozicii grigoryangrafika inzynierska wyklad 3 colorlab grafika2D 3 zadaniaElementy grafiki inzynierskiej?1więcej podobnych podstron